Nicholas Serota to leave Tate after three decades in charge
Nicholas Serota is stepping down as director of the Tate after 28 years in charge to be the next chairman of Arts Council England. The move next February, announced today (7 September), months after the opening of a new wing of Tate Modern (Switch House) will come as a surprise to many although there has been speculation, first reported in the Sunday Times, that such a move was on the cards.
